Check for Water Leaks
Posted on Jul 6th, 2016

The Board asks you to check regularly for leaks in or around your kitchen, bathroom, hot water heater, dishwasher, and clothes washer. Fix any leaks as soon as they are found to avoid expensive repairs.
 
Water leaks will cause damage to your unit and possibly to your neighbor's unit. The owner of the unit where the leak originates is primarily responsible for the repairs.
 
There are a number of inexpensive water alarms available from Amazon and others (see the photo). These alarms detect tiny amounts of water and make a sound like a smoke alarm.
 
Make sure your unit is leak-free and that you have water alarms to detect water leaks quickly.
